Giles and Steve are back with another episode full of joy and tears, They've got lots to talk about in this one! Including the legendary "joke" band Twat’s Garden and 90's gig partner Misterlee.
Will they choose a song for their Best Of compilation? Have they broken the podcast? You'll have to listen to find out.
